Household slicers, also referred to as food slicers or kitchen slicers, have become indispensable tools in modern kitchens, catering to the needs of home cooks seeking precision and efficiency in food preparation. These versatile appliances are adept at slicing a variety of food items, including vegetables, fruits, meats, cheeses, and bread, with consistent results. By offering adjustable blades and thickness settings, household slicers empower users to customize their slices according to their culinary preferences, whether it's for salads, sandwiches, or charcuterie boards.

Segment Analysis
Manual slicers are traditional hand-operated devices that require physical effort from the user to slice food items. These slicers are often simple in design and are suitable for small-scale slicing tasks. On the other hand, automatic slicers are powered by electricity or batteries, offering greater convenience and efficiency. Automatic slicers typically feature motorized blades that slice through food items with minimal manual effort, making them ideal for high-volume slicing needs or for users seeking enhanced ease of use.

Global Household Slicer Market, Segmentation by Geography
In this report, the Global Household Slicer Market has been segmented by Geography into five regions; North America, Europe, Asia Pacific, Middle East and Africa and Latin America.
Global Household Slicer Market Share (%), by Geographical Region, 2023
In 2019, North America dominated the household slicer market, holding the largest share of 33.2%. This dominance is attributed to the rising demand for stylish, sleek, and comfortable slicers in the region. Consumers increasingly prefer slicers made from steel due to their ease of handling during slicing and their high durability. This preference for steel slicers is expected to continue driving innovation and new product development among market players, thereby fueling further growth in the North American household slicer market.
Asia Pacific is poised to witness the fastest growth in the forecast period, with a projected CAGR of 6.2% from 2020 to 2027. Key markets driving this growth include China, India, Japan, South Korea, Hong Kong, Singapore, and Indonesia. In these countries, there is a higher penetration and accessibility of utility slicers in residential sectors, leading consumers to opt for low- and medium-priced products. However, there is also a growing willingness among consumers to invest in premium-quality traditional tools for experimenting with new cuisines, which is expected to drive demand for household slicers in the region.
